Govt Keeps Petrol Price Unchanged, Diesel Sees Slight Cut
The caretaker federal government has announced the revised petroleum prices for the next fortnight. There has been no change in the price of petrol as it remains unchanged at Rs. 281.34 per liter. The price of high-speed diesel has been slashed by Rs. 7 per liter to Rs. 289.71. Similarly, the price of kerosene has been cut by Rs. 3.82 per liter to Rs. 201.16, while the price of light diesel oil has been reduced by Rs. 4.52 to Rs. 175.93. The new prices will be effective from December 1, 2023. It is pertinent to mention here that at the last fortnightly review of petroleum prices, the government cut the price of petrol by Rs. 2.04 per liter while the price of high-speed diesel was slashed by Rs. 6.47 per liter.
